Are There EV Charging Stations in Rural Areas?

Yes, EV charging stations exist in rural areas, though options are fewer and spread farther apart than in metropolitan regions.

Federal initiatives like the National Electric Vehicle Infrastructure program allocate billions for rural and underserved areas. These programs focus on filling gaps along interstate corridors and connecting isolated communities to charging networks. Rural electric cooperatives have become key partners in this expansion, leveraging their existing infrastructure and community relationships to identify optimal station locations.

Challenges of EV Charging in Rural Areas

EV charging infrastructure challenges in rural areas create distinct obstacles that urban drivers rarely encounter:

  • Stations can be 50 to 100 miles apart on some routes, requiring careful route planning

  • Infrastructure investment has historically favored high-traffic urban corridors, leaving many rural highways and secondary roads underserved

  • Power grid limitations in remote areas can slow new station installations

  • Winter weather and extreme temperatures can affect both charging speeds and vehicle range

These challenges are easing as technology advances and investment catches up:

  • Battery technology is extending EV range

  • Grid modernization projects are strengthening rural electrical systems

  • Innovative solutions such as solar-powered stations are making remote charging possible

  • Federal and state programs now prioritize rural access

  • Private companies see rural markets as growth opportunities

Together, these advances are turning rural charging from a challenge to an opportunity.

How to Plan EV Travel in Rural Areas

Rural travel requires more preparation than city driving, but following these steps makes trips smooth, stress-free, and helps boost your range confidence:

Route Planning

  • Map your entire route using EV-specific navigation apps that show charging station locations and real-time availability

  • Identify charging stops every 100–150 miles rather than pushing your vehicle's maximum range

  • Research backup charging options along your route in case primary stations are offline or occupied

  • Check station types and charging speeds to estimate stop duration accurately

Pre-Trip Preparation

  • Charge your vehicle to 100% before departing, giving you maximum flexibility for the first leg of your journey

  • Download offline maps and charging station information for areas with poor cell coverage

  • Pack emergency supplies, including water, snacks, and weather-appropriate gear for extended charging stops

  • Bring portable charging cables and adapters that work with different station types

Timing Considerations

  • Plan charging stops during meal times or when you want to explore local attractions

  • Allow extra time for slower charging speeds at rural stations, which may not offer the fastest DC options

  • Consider seasonal factors like cold weather that can reduce both range and charging efficiency

  • Build buffer time into your schedule for unexpected delays or detours

Smart planning transforms rural EV travel from a source of anxiety into an opportunity to discover new places while your vehicle charges.

How Far Can You Drive Between Charges in Rural Areas?

Many modern EVs can travel 200–300 miles on a full charge, but in rural areas it is smart to plan stops every 100–150 miles to maintain a buffer. Charging infrastructure may be spaced farther apart, and some locations only offer Level 2 charging.

Level 2 charging can take several hours depending on your vehicle, while DC fast charging can significantly reduce stop time. However, actual charging speed depends on your vehicle’s battery size and the maximum power it can accept. Level 2 (AC) charging and DC fast charging function differently, and while some chargers are capable of higher output, your vehicle ultimately determines how much power it can receive.

Even at a high-powered DC fast charger, charging may occur more slowly if your vehicle is limited to a lower intake rate, which is why charging speeds can vary between vehicles at the same station.

Understanding Charging Expectations

Charging performance in rural areas depends on several factors beyond station availability:

  • Charging speed depends on both the charger and your vehicle’s maximum acceptance rate

  • Plug-in hybrid electric vehicles (PHEVs) typically rely on Level 2 charging and are not compatible with DC fast charging

  • Extreme temperatures can reduce range and increase charging time

Understanding these variables helps drivers plan rural trips with greater confidence and fewer surprises.

Plan Around Weather Conditions

Cold weather can reduce driving range and slow charging due to increased energy demand for heating. Hot summer conditions can also impact range through air conditioning use. In rural areas with limited charging options, adjusting routes and stops based on forecasts helps prevent unexpected range loss.

Monitor Station Status Before Arriving

Rural stations often receive less maintenance attention than urban locations, making real-time status checks crucial. Use apps to verify stations are operational before driving there, and always have backup locations identified. Some rural areas still have only one charging option within 50 miles.

Understand Grid Limitations

Rural grids may support slower charging speeds during peak usage or extreme weather. Even when infrastructure allows for higher output, your vehicle’s onboard charging system ultimately determines how quickly it can charge.
